Development of Thermoelectric Cooled Single-Mode Distributed Feedback Mid-IR Interband Cascade Lasers for Chemical Sensing 2007-01-3151
The recent development of single-mode continuous wave distributed feedback mid-IR interband cascade lasers operating at thermoelectric cooler temperatures is presented. Also, latest progress of interband cascade lasers is reported.
